Aussie Tourist Surge Lifts NZ Tourism
10+ hour, 45+ min ago (281+ words) New Zealand tourism numbers are continuing to strengthen, with international visitor arrivals for July exceeding 2019 levels, Tourism and Hospitality Minister Louise Upston says. Figures released today by Statistics New Zealand show 256,600 overseas visitor arrivals in July 2026, up 8.5 percent on July…...

Greens Promise $200m Into Te Reo Māori Initiatives
10+ hour, 49+ min ago (418+ words) The Green Party will put an extra $200 million into te reo Māori initiatives, if elected. The party announced its policy on the first day of Te Wiki o Te Reo Māori. It would spend an extra $30 million each year on…...
